知行编程网知行编程网  2022-10-29 19:30 知行编程网 隐藏边栏  15 
文章评分 0 次,平均分 0.0
导语: 本文主要介绍了关于python导出excel乱码怎么解决的相关知识,希望可以帮到处于编程学习途中的小伙伴

如何解决python导出excel乱码

使用python+win32com将网页的表格导出到本地excel,遇到输出乱码的问题。

解决方法:

将x改为x.decode('utf-8')即可。

setCall('sheet1',row,col,x.decode('utf-8'))

我的部分源码:

self.xlBook = self.xlApp.Workbooks.Add()
    def setCell(self,sheet,row,col,value):#设置单元格的数据
        "Set value of one cell"
        sht = self.xlBook.Worksheets(sheet)
        print row,col
        sht.Cells(row,col).Value = value
setCall('sheet1',i,j,x.decode('utf-8'))

本文为原创文章,版权归所有,欢迎分享本文,转载请保留出处!

知行编程网
知行编程网 关注:1    粉丝:1
这个人很懒,什么都没写
扫一扫二维码分享